入门级软件开发教学:新手如何选择合适的编程环境

时间:2025-12-07 分类:电脑软件

快速发展的科技领域对新手程序员提出了更高的要求,尤其是在选择合适的编程环境时。编程环境不仅影响学习的效率,也能极大地影响开发的体验。对于刚入门的程序员来说,如何挑选适合自己的编程环境尤为关键。本篇文章将探讨当前市场上各大编程环境的特点,并提供一些实用建议,帮助新手找到理想的开发工具。

入门级软件开发教学:新手如何选择合适的编程环境

每种编程环境都有其独特的优势和局限性。对于大多数新手来说,Visual Studio Code(VSCode)和PyCharm是非常受欢迎的选择。VSCode作为一款轻量级的开源编辑器,以其丰富的扩展功能和良好的社区支持而闻名。无论是Web开发、数据科学还是其他领域,VSCode都能满足不同需求。而PyCharm则专注于Python开发,为初学者提供了众多便捷的功能,如代码自动补全和错误检测,这无疑能帮助新手迅速掌握编程技巧。

对于那些希望参与到移动应用开发的程序员,Android Studio仍然是不错的选择。其集成的Android SDK工具包使得Android应用的开发变得简单明了。尤其是对那些有志于开发Android应用的新手来说,Android Studio提供的模板和即时代码帮助能够大大降低学习的门槛。Xcode是iOS开发者的理想选择,具备了强大的调试功能和高效的界面构建工具,适合对苹果平台开发感兴趣的新手。

在硬件方面,选择一台合适的电脑同样重要。最新的处理器和显卡不仅有助于提升编程效率,还能更好地支持虚拟机和模型训练等需求。例如,配备了最新英特尔或AMD处理器的电脑能够在编译大型项目时表现得游刃有余,而高性能的显卡则对于图形开发尤为重要。对于有DIY组装能力的用户,选择合适的硬件配件进行组装可以有效降低成本,并打造一台适合自己需求的开发设备。

性能优化同样是新手程序员在使用编程环境时必须关注的内容。适当的配置和调整可以显著提升开发效率。建议定期清理不必要的插件,并保持开发环境的整洁,以免造成资源浪费。学习一些调试技巧和代码优化的基本原则,可以帮助新手在编写代码时养成良好的习惯。

选择合适的编程环境是一门技术活,涉及到个人喜好、项目需求和硬件性能等多个方面。了解不同开发工具的特点,并根据自己的实际情况进行选择,必能让新手在编程的道路上走得更加顺畅。

常见问题解答(FAQ)

1. 新手应该如何选择编程语言?

- 选择编程语言时可以考虑项目需求、就业市场和个人兴趣。如对数据分析感兴趣,可以选择Python;如果想进行Web开发,JavaScript是个不错的选择。

2. 什么是IDE,为什么重要?

- IDE(集成开发环境)是一种软件应用,提供了开发所需的许多功能,如代码编辑、调试和构建工具等。良好的IDE能极大提升开发效率和学习体验。

3. 如何选择合适的硬件进行软件开发?

- 对于软件开发,重点考虑处理器性能和内存容量。四核及以上的处理器和至少8GB的RAM能满足大多数开发需求。

4. 学习编程时应该怎样获取支持?

- 可以通过参加在线课程、加入编程社区或论坛,以及寻求有经验开发者的指导来获取支持和帮助。

5. 性能优化有哪些简单的技巧?

- 保持开发工具的简洁,定期清理不必要的插件,使用合适的代码格式,并学习调试技巧以提高代码运行效率。